Non-turbo turboed track time

Hey guys so I turboed my 91 non turbo talon 4 or 5 months ago, running a totally stock tsi setup with 9:1 non turbo pistons. The other day we went to the track and ran some runs. On 9 psi I pulled off 14.4s at 99mph. it was so cold out that I kept spinning through 1st and 2nd, but I thought it was still pretty good seeing a non turbo talon there was running 18s. I wanted to run way more boost seeing as I wasnt knocking at all but my boost controller was being a pain and not working right. does anybody else out there with a nonturbo to turbo setup have any good times to brag about? Im curious to see what the NT motors have in em.

Re: Non-turbo turboed track time

wow thats very impressive! ya the main thing holding me back now is my fuel pump, running out of juice around 6200. I plan on replacing that pretty soon. So was the rs-t a 420a or a 4g63? Ive seen the 420as do some impressive times however I would imagion the 4g63nts to be a better motor. I hate people that tell me I can't put boost to my motor! Sure these internals were never meant for boost however the 9:1 pistons were designed with the exact same material properties as the 7.8:1 pistons, only difference is higher compression. therefore just run a bit lower boost thus lowering the internal compression ratio.
